Диммер

Аватара пользователя
sveloga
Рядовой
Сообщения: 39
Зарегистрирован: 12 июл 2016, 09:36
Контактная информация:

Диммер

Сообщение sveloga »

Работает.
Пока не разобрался с самим flpgor немого, с пользовательскими блоками. В логику не совсем въехал.

Руками писал без flprog. Работало отлично. Регулируется с ИК пульта.
Аватара пользователя
DerAlex
Лейтенант
Сообщения: 437
Зарегистрирован: 06 сен 2015, 08:39
Откуда: Новосибирск

Диммер

Сообщение DerAlex »

Сделайте простую схему в FLProg . Добейтесь результата. а потом можно усложнить.
аврора
Аватара пользователя
sveloga
Рядовой
Сообщения: 39
Зарегистрирован: 12 июл 2016, 09:36
Контактная информация:

Диммер

Сообщение sveloga »

Простейшее и делаю.



Работает, если нет других блоков, кроме Dimmer.
Если добавить отслеживание нажатий на nextion, например, то нет :(
Так понимаю, что мой блок не работает, пока все ждут команду.
Чего там на стороне nextion, ИМХО не важно.
У вас нет необходимых прав для просмотра вложений в этом сообщении.
Последний раз редактировалось sveloga 20 июл 2016, 06:54, всего редактировалось 1 раз.
Аватара пользователя
DerAlex
Лейтенант
Сообщения: 437
Зарегистрирован: 06 сен 2015, 08:39
Откуда: Новосибирск

Диммер

Сообщение DerAlex »

Что за блок Dimmer ?
аврора
Аватара пользователя
sveloga
Рядовой
Сообщения: 39
Зарегистрирован: 12 июл 2016, 09:36
Контактная информация:

Диммер

Сообщение sveloga »

мой блок.
он во вложении в моем предыдущем сообщении.
Аватара пользователя
DerAlex
Лейтенант
Сообщения: 437
Зарегистрирован: 06 сен 2015, 08:39
Откуда: Новосибирск

Диммер

Сообщение DerAlex »

Подробнее можно о блоке.Не все понятно.
аврора
Аватара пользователя
sveloga
Рядовой
Сообщения: 39
Зарегистрирован: 12 июл 2016, 09:36
Контактная информация:

Диммер

Сообщение sveloga »

Сделан на основе этого
В коде есть коменты.
Честно говоря, мне самому не все понятно, как это работает.
Убрал лишнее и тупо копи/паст...

Тут ссылка на тему с написанием под эту железку.
Последний раз редактировалось sveloga 20 июл 2016, 10:06, всего редактировалось 1 раз.
Аватара пользователя
DerAlex
Лейтенант
Сообщения: 437
Зарегистрирован: 06 сен 2015, 08:39
Откуда: Новосибирск

Диммер

Сообщение DerAlex »

Несколько каналов работает ? Или только один.Если работают несколько, сильно лампы мигают ?
аврора
Аватара пользователя
sveloga
Рядовой
Сообщения: 39
Зарегистрирован: 12 июл 2016, 09:36
Контактная информация:

Диммер

Сообщение sveloga »

Многоканальность, за ненадобностью выпилил.
т.е. только один.

Ниже, рабочий вариант на 1 диммер с регулировкой с ИК-пульта


У вас нет необходимых прав для просмотра вложений в этом сообщении.
Novichok
Рядовой
Сообщения: 54
Зарегистрирован: 05 окт 2015, 17:17

Диммер

Сообщение Novichok »

http://flprog.ru/forum/18-898-1

У меня 8 месяцев работает 4 канальный димер в конце есть видео

правда в плохом качестве там-же есть блок для управления в описание написана его работа
Последний раз редактировалось Novichok 11 янв 2017, 14:36, всего редактировалось 1 раз.
Novichok
Рядовой
Сообщения: 54
Зарегистрирован: 05 окт 2015, 17:17

Диммер

Сообщение Novichok »

Вот исходник можно добавлять сколько надо больше 4 каналов не тестировал
У вас нет необходимых прав для просмотра вложений в этом сообщении.
Последний раз редактировалось Novichok 18 фев 2017, 12:03, всего редактировалось 1 раз.
Arkabai
Рядовой
Сообщения: 12
Зарегистрирован: 09 апр 2017, 14:18
Откуда: Shymkent

Диммер

Сообщение Arkabai »

Подскажите про скоростной счетчик
собираю контактную сварку хочу использовать скоростной счетчик как синхроимпульс
есть заданная величина импульса она относительно импульса с скорост счетчика подается на тревдотельное реле
никак не получается линию задержки использовать как начало имп для вых.
Аватара пользователя
support
Супермодератор
Сообщения: 1917
Зарегистрирован: 03 янв 2018, 11:45
Откуда: Астрахань
Имя: Сергей
Поблагодарили: 23 раза
Контактная информация:

Диммер

Сообщение support »

Твердотельные реле не подойдёт для это цели. В нем для уменьшения помех при включении установлена оптопара со встроенным детектором нуля и она открывает симистор сразу после перехода фазы через ноль вне зависимости от момента прихода импулься. Если импульс короче полуволны (как в нашем случае) симистор вообще не открывается
Автор программы FLProg.
pan
Полковник
Сообщения: 2860
Зарегистрирован: 13 апр 2017, 11:57
Имя: noname

Диммер

Сообщение pan »

была тема про регулятор мощности. можно попробовать и так ТЫЦ
Аватара пользователя
sveloga
Рядовой
Сообщения: 39
Зарегистрирован: 12 июл 2016, 09:36
Контактная информация:

Диммер

Сообщение sveloga »

Novichok писал(а):Вот исходник можно добавлять сколько надо больше 4 каналов не тестировалПрикрепления: _4__.flp(800Kb)
а можете пояснить для непонятливых как это работает?
Что и куда подключать(физически)?
ZeRG
Рядовой
Сообщения: 52
Зарегистрирован: 28 май 2017, 00:28

Диммер

Сообщение ZeRG »

РАБОЧИЙ ДИММЕР НА 6 ВЫХОДОВ ДЛЯ УНО НО НЕ ЧЕРЕЗ ФЛПРОГ

Отправлено спустя 7 минут 50 секунд:
есть люди котором в этом понимают?)))
У вас нет необходимых прав для просмотра вложений в этом сообщении.
Аватара пользователя
Sancho
Полковник
Сообщения: 4066
Зарегистрирован: 25 дек 2015, 17:32
Откуда: Ярославль.
Имя: Александр
Поблагодарили: 5 раз
Контактная информация:

Диммер

Сообщение Sancho »

ZeRG писал(а): 02 апр 2018, 11:55есть люди котором в этом понимают?)))
Всё понятно.
Блок нужен?
На сколько штук, какие пины будут задействованы.
Можно сделать и назначаемыми, но работать будет медленнее - если только димер в программе, тогда без разницы.
мой ник в нете и почте omelchuk890, если что. запомните на всякий. многие знают номер тлф.
ZeRG
Рядовой
Сообщения: 52
Зарегистрирован: 28 май 2017, 00:28

Диммер

Сообщение ZeRG »

Sancho писал(а): 02 апр 2018, 12:39но работать будет медленнее
не понял в каком случае медленнее?

Отправлено спустя 1 минуту :
Сделал на 6 выходов может кому пригодится

Отправлено спустя 10 минут 40 секунд:
хотя мой блок работает только с константами почему?
У вас нет необходимых прав для просмотра вложений в этом сообщении.
Аватара пользователя
Sancho
Полковник
Сообщения: 4066
Зарегистрирован: 25 дек 2015, 17:32
Откуда: Ярославль.
Имя: Александр
Поблагодарили: 5 раз
Контактная информация:

Диммер

Сообщение Sancho »

ZeRG писал(а): 02 апр 2018, 13:39хотя мой блок работает только с константами почему?
Невнимательность. Посмотри функцию timer_interrupt() и названия своих входов - разные.

Отправлено спустя 45 минут 48 секунд:
ZeRG писал(а): 02 апр 2018, 13:39не понял в каком случае медленнее?
Потому, что вот этот участок кода, когда все условия будут истинны
[spoiler]

Код: Выделить всё

  if(Dimmer1 < tic ) D4_High; //управляем выходом
  if(Dimmer2 < tic ) D5_High;  //управляем выходом
  if(Dimmer3 < tic ) D6_High;  //управляем выходом 
  if(Dimmer1 < tic ) D7_High; //управляем выходом
  if(Dimmer2 < tic ) D8_High;  //управляем выходом
  if(Dimmer3 < tic ) D9_High;  //управляем выходом 
[/spoiler]
выполняется 3,16 мкс, а вот это
[spoiler]

Код: Выделить всё

if (tic > Dimmer1)            // если настало время включать ток
    digitalWrite(dimPin1, 1);   // врубить ток
  if (tic > Dimmer2)            // если настало время включать ток
    digitalWrite(dimPin2, 1);   // врубить ток
  if (tic > Dimmer3)            // если настало время включать ток
    digitalWrite(dimPin3, 1);   // врубить ток
  if (tic > Dimmer4)            // если настало время включать ток
    digitalWrite(dimPin4, 1);   // врубить ток
  if (tic > Dimmer5)            // если настало время включать ток
    digitalWrite(dimPin5, 1);   // врубить ток
  if (tic > Dimmer6)            // если настало время включать ток
    digitalWrite(dimPin6, 1);   // врубить ток
[/spoiler]
за время 27,4 мкс
При том, что таймер вызывает обработку каждые 40 мкс, на работу остальной программы остаётся 40 - 27,4=12,6 мкс....
Как-то так, может не прав...
мой ник в нете и почте omelchuk890, если что. запомните на всякий. многие знают номер тлф.
ZeRG
Рядовой
Сообщения: 52
Зарегистрирован: 28 май 2017, 00:28

Диммер

Сообщение ZeRG »

я не множко не понял в смысле контроллер зависает?
Ответить

Вернуться в «Проекты различных устройств на Arduino»

Кто сейчас на конференции

Сейчас этот форум просматривают: нет зарегистрированных пользователей и 3 гостя